Virginia Creech Price


Virginia Creech Price, 87 of Lucama passed away Friday, June 14, 2024. Funeral services will be held at 11 a.m. Thursday, June 20, 2024, at Joyner’s Funeral Home, Wilson. Interment will follow in Upper Black Creek Cemetery, Lucama. Rev. David Kriger and Pastor Billy Sander will officiate.

 The family will receive friends Wednesday evening, June 19, 2024, from 6 – 8 p.m. at Joyner’s Funeral Home, 4100 Raleigh Road Parkway, Wilson.

 Virginia was beautiful inside and out. She was a remarkable woman who embodied spunk, wanderlust, and entrepreneurial spirit. As the valedictorian of her class at Glendale High School, she set the stage for life of achievement. Always working in the yard, her passion for flowers bloomed into Price’s Nursery in Lucama and a business that thrived in downtown Wilson. From seed store to garden center, and eventually a florist and gift shop, Virginia’s creativity knew no bounds.

 Her leadership extended beyond business. She earned numerous service awards through the Wilson County Extension Service, spearheading beautification projects with St. Mary’s Jr. Extension Homemakers and St. Mary’s 4-H. Virginia’s eye for detail and perfection graced countless weddings across North Carolina. She had the unique ability to turn a simple family gathering, reunion or celebration into a fun-filled themed event that welcomed everyone.

 Virginia’s zest for life extended beyond her garden and business ventures. She had an uncanny ability to weave enchantment into everyday occasions. From tea parties with her grandchildren to playful gatherings, her themed parties and events were legendary. Whether it was a Snoopy Christmas, a summer gathering, a special anniversary or birthday celebration, Virginia’s creativity knew no bounds. Her laughter-filled gatherings brought people together, leaving cherished memories etched in our hearts. 

 Even in retirement, she remained active in the community, finding joy in fellowship with friends and her church. As a dedicated wife and caregiver to her husband of fifty-three years, Billy Ray Price, Virginia exemplified love and commitment.

 Virginia is survived by her son, Bill Price (Joy) of Lucama, and her daughter, Beth Price Skinner (Keith) of Wake Forest. Her legacy lives on through seven grandchildren, Mary Sander (Billy), William Price (Casie), Joshua Price, Rebecca Talton (Schyler), Hannah Boone (Tyler), Wesley Skinner and Ashley Skinner; six great-grandchildren, Riley, Sophie, Corbin, Jeremiah, Brenna, and Olivia to carry forward her spirit, and her sister, Martha Spencer (Kent) of Wilson and Carol Creech of Clayton, and Steve Creech of Selma.

 She was preceded in death by her husband of fifty-three years, Billy Ray Price; parents, Eddie and Miggie Creech, and sisters, Lou Johnson, and Betty Jean Johnson.
